rust-lightning/lightning/src/ln
Matt Corallo b2bf57eb82 [bindings] Don't export new functions with unexportable types
`CommitmentTransaction::new_with_auxiliary_htlc_data()` includes a
unbounded generic parameter which we can't concretize and it's of
limited immediate use for users in any case. We should eventually
add a non-generic version which uses `()` for the generic but that
can come later.

`CommitmentTransaction::htlcs()` returns a reference to a Vec,
which we cannot currently map. It should, however, be exposed to
users, so in the future we'll need to have a duplication function
which returns Vec of references or a cloned Vec.
2021-02-02 17:04:31 -05:00
..
chan_utils.rs [bindings] Don't export new functions with unexportable types 2021-02-02 17:04:31 -05:00
chanmon_update_fail_tests.rs Merge pull request #764 from lightning-signer/revoke-enforcement 2021-01-25 09:06:43 -08:00
channel.rs Fold sign_holder_commitment_htlc_transactions into sign_holder_commitment 2021-01-18 10:24:31 -08:00
channelmanager.rs Makes ChannelManager::force_close_channel fail for unknown chan_ids 2021-01-21 16:12:57 +01:00
features.rs Change routing table sync to use gossip_queries 2020-12-14 12:52:54 -05:00
functional_test_utils.rs Let some tests disable revocation policy check 2021-01-21 11:37:28 -08:00
functional_tests.rs Merge pull request #764 from lightning-signer/revoke-enforcement 2021-01-25 09:06:43 -08:00
mod.rs Put test utilities behind a feature flag. 2020-10-16 11:30:33 -04:00
msgs.rs [bindings] Use consistent imports for MessageSendEvents traits 2021-02-01 16:52:57 -05:00
onchaintx.rs Revocation enforcement in signer 2021-01-18 17:59:43 -08:00
onion_route_tests.rs Move channelmonitor.rs from ln to chain module 2020-09-30 22:41:52 -07:00
onion_utils.rs fix all clippy::redundant_field_names warnings 2020-10-07 11:20:21 -07:00
peer_channel_encryptor.rs fix all clippy::redundant_field_names warnings 2020-10-07 11:20:21 -07:00
peer_handler.rs Add PeerManager::disconnect_by_node_id() 2021-02-01 14:13:37 -05:00
reorg_tests.rs Move channelmonitor.rs from ln to chain module 2020-09-30 22:41:52 -07:00
wire.rs Add gossip_queries messages to wire decoding 2020-12-01 17:18:24 -05:00